Qualifications:

  • Master’s degree in Speech-Language Pathology or Communication Sciences
  • Valid SLP license for Georgia
  •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C-SLP) or Clinical Fellowship Year (CFY) candidates welcome
  • Experience working with pediatric populations in schools and/or healthcare settings
  • Comfortable collaborating with a multidisciplinary team, including other SLPs and SLPAs
  • Strong skills in individualized assessment, treatment planning, and documentation
  • Commitment to evidence-based practice and student advocacy

Responsibilities:

  • Deliver direct and consultative speech-language therapy services for students in grades K–12
  • Develop and implement IEP goals tailored to individual needs
  • Conduct comprehensive speech and language assessments
  • Document progress and maintain accurate communication with educational staff and families
  • Participate in IEP meetings and interdisciplinary collaboration
  • Contribute expertise to a dynamic team in a multiple-school environment
  • Maintain compliance with state and district policies (No Medicaid billing required)
